DESCRIPTION

All included program in the Codpa Valley Lodge, located at an altitude of 2,050 meters a.s.l., of prehispanic origin, was the residence of the cacique (chief) of the “Altos de Arica” (Arican Highlands), who governed the tribes of Socoroma, Putre, Parinacota, Livilcar and Tignamar, among others. In the mountains at the beginning of the Vitor River the water is pure, the climate is temperate, and the ground is highly fertile. Here many kinds of fruits can grow, especially guavas, and codpa grapes. These grapes are used for making the well known Pintatani Wine, thick and tasty, harvested from the end of March to the beginning of April. Codpa is the traditional place of relaxation for the Aricans.

Is located 50 meters above sea level and 110 km from Arica towards the South during the prehispanic era, the residence of the Cacique (chief) of the “Altos de Arica” (Arican highlands), governed over Socoroma, Putre, Livilcar, Ticnamar and other towns.
Due to the location, at the top of the Vitor River, the waters are pure and the terrain is fertile, making this place excellent for growing avocados, guavas, quince, citrus fruits and grapes, which are the main ingredient in the making of the traditional “Pintatani Wine”.

It's name coming from “Suri”, a name used by the Aymaras for the nandu, a species of Chilean Ostrich that lives in this zone and that can be seen during this tour. The salt flat, with its large surface area, appears majestic. Its saline deposits creating an intense white which strongly contrasts with the blue waters of the lagoons. Added to this is the permanent habitation of a large population of 3 of the 6 species of flamengos in the world. These salt flats are the place where the flamengos reproduce, as well as the habitat of a considerable number of other wildlife species. The regular encounter with flamengos feeding and fluttering above the lagoons together with a number of groups of Vicunas and Suris en the fields is very attractive. The presence of the Hot Spring pools (Polloquere Springs) is inviting for recreation and relaxation.

Located 3,500 meters a.s.l., with 1,205 inhabitants. This place was established as a town in 1580 by Spanish settlers in charge of traffic between Potosi and Arica. Government houses, town hall, the church parish house and the church built in 1670 are located around the Plaza de Armas (center square). The main tourist attractions are the Surire Salt Flats, the Lauca National Park, the Jurasi Hot Springs, the snow covered mountains of Tarapaca and the Vicuna National Reserve. The Vilakaure geoglyphs, that show the importance of the pre hispanic cultures, are just 8 km away.

The Lauca National Park is located in the I Region, has a surface area of 137,883 hectares, and is in the district of Putre, in the province of Parinacota. It includes the foothills and highlands in the extreme North East of the Tarapaca Region.
Of notable mention in the park are the Chungara Lake, The Parinacota Volcanos: Pomerape, Guallarite and Acotango. In the highland areas there are also volcanic calderas such as Ajoya, the Tejene and lava fields like Cotacotani. At Chungara Lake you can do a variety of activities such as excursions, and observation of plants and wildlife.
